James of Arran has been producing the finest quality handmade chocolates for over 17 years, using only the finest ingredients from around the world. Beautifully presented, high quality chocolates.
James of Arran has been producing the finest quality handmade chocolates for over 17 years, using only the finest ingredients from around the world. Beautifully presented, high quality chocolates.